As the leading mobility company, we work with tires, around tires and beyond tires to enable Motion for Life. Dedicated to enhancing our clients’ mobility and sustainability, Michelin designs and distributes the most suitable tires, services and solutions for our customers’ needs. Michelin provides digital services, maps and guides to help enrich trips and travels and make them unique experiences. Bringing our expertise to new markets, we invest in high-technology materials, 3D printing and hydrogen, to serve a wide a variety of industries—from aerospace to biotech. Headquartered in Greenville, South Carolina, Michelin North America has approximately 23,000 employees and operates 34 production facilities in the United States and Canada.

MICHELIN® tires have been ranked the #1 Tire Brand across major categories and segments by industry experts and consumers alike. For nearly three decades we’ve been recognized for our achievements in Customer Satisfaction, Performance, Durability, Technology and Innovation.
